Skip to content

Commit 1730b2d

Browse files
authored
Rollup merge of #145858 - alexcrichton:update-wasm-component-ld, r=lqd
Update wasm-component-ld dependency Keeping it up-to-date with the latest changes/features.
2 parents 30f7ddc + 85b5ec9 commit 1730b2d

File tree

3 files changed

+31
-43
lines changed

3 files changed

+31
-43
lines changed

Cargo.lock

Lines changed: 30 additions & 41 deletions
Original file line numberDiff line numberDiff line change
@@ -5989,9 +5989,9 @@ dependencies = [
59895989

59905990
[[package]]
59915991
name = "wasi-preview1-component-adapter-provider"
5992-
version = "34.0.2"
5992+
version = "36.0.1"
59935993
source = "registry+https://github.com/rust-lang/crates.io-index"
5994-
checksum = "33696c5f1ff1e083de9f36c3da471abd736362bc173e093f8b0b1ed5a387e39b"
5994+
checksum = "20689c88791776219f78c2529700d15e6a9bd57a27858c62e9ef8487956b571c"
59955995

59965996
[[package]]
59975997
name = "wasm-bindgen"
@@ -6053,17 +6053,17 @@ dependencies = [
60536053

60546054
[[package]]
60556055
name = "wasm-component-ld"
6056-
version = "0.5.15"
6056+
version = "0.5.16"
60576057
source = "registry+https://github.com/rust-lang/crates.io-index"
6058-
checksum = "6d95124e34fee1316222e03b9bbf41af186ecbae2c8b79f8debe6e21b3ff60c5"
6058+
checksum = "14cd35d6cae91109a0ffd207b573cf3c741cab7e921dd376ea7aaf2c52a3408c"
60596059
dependencies = [
60606060
"anyhow",
60616061
"clap",
60626062
"lexopt",
60636063
"libc",
60646064
"tempfile",
60656065
"wasi-preview1-component-adapter-provider",
6066-
"wasmparser 0.234.0",
6066+
"wasmparser 0.237.0",
60676067
"wat",
60686068
"windows-sys 0.59.0",
60696069
"winsplit",
@@ -6090,34 +6090,24 @@ dependencies = [
60906090

60916091
[[package]]
60926092
name = "wasm-encoder"
6093-
version = "0.234.0"
6094-
source = "registry+https://github.com/rust-lang/crates.io-index"
6095-
checksum = "170a0157eef517a179f2d20ed7c68df9c3f7f6c1c047782d488bf5a464174684"
6096-
dependencies = [
6097-
"leb128fmt",
6098-
"wasmparser 0.234.0",
6099-
]
6100-
6101-
[[package]]
6102-
name = "wasm-encoder"
6103-
version = "0.236.1"
6093+
version = "0.237.0"
61046094
source = "registry+https://github.com/rust-lang/crates.io-index"
6105-
checksum = "724fccfd4f3c24b7e589d333fc0429c68042897a7e8a5f8694f31792471841e7"
6095+
checksum = "efe92d1321afa53ffc88a57c497bb7330c3cf84c98ffdba4a4caf6a0684fad3c"
61066096
dependencies = [
61076097
"leb128fmt",
6108-
"wasmparser 0.236.1",
6098+
"wasmparser 0.237.0",
61096099
]
61106100

61116101
[[package]]
61126102
name = "wasm-metadata"
6113-
version = "0.234.0"
6103+
version = "0.237.0"
61146104
source = "registry+https://github.com/rust-lang/crates.io-index"
6115-
checksum = "a42fe3f5cbfb56fc65311ef827930d06189160038e81db62188f66b4bf468e3a"
6105+
checksum = "4cc0b0a0c4f35ca6efa7a797671372915d4e9659dba2d59edc6fafc931d19997"
61166106
dependencies = [
61176107
"anyhow",
61186108
"indexmap",
6119-
"wasm-encoder 0.234.0",
6120-
"wasmparser 0.234.0",
6109+
"wasm-encoder 0.237.0",
6110+
"wasmparser 0.237.0",
61216111
]
61226112

61236113
[[package]]
@@ -6132,46 +6122,45 @@ dependencies = [
61326122

61336123
[[package]]
61346124
name = "wasmparser"
6135-
version = "0.234.0"
6125+
version = "0.236.1"
61366126
source = "registry+https://github.com/rust-lang/crates.io-index"
6137-
checksum = "be22e5a8f600afce671dd53c8d2dd26b4b7aa810fd18ae27dfc49737f3e02fc5"
6127+
checksum = "a9b1e81f3eb254cf7404a82cee6926a4a3ccc5aad80cc3d43608a070c67aa1d7"
61386128
dependencies = [
61396129
"bitflags",
6140-
"hashbrown",
61416130
"indexmap",
6142-
"semver",
6143-
"serde",
61446131
]
61456132

61466133
[[package]]
61476134
name = "wasmparser"
6148-
version = "0.236.1"
6135+
version = "0.237.0"
61496136
source = "registry+https://github.com/rust-lang/crates.io-index"
6150-
checksum = "a9b1e81f3eb254cf7404a82cee6926a4a3ccc5aad80cc3d43608a070c67aa1d7"
6137+
checksum = "7d2a40ca0d2bdf4b0bf36c13a737d0b2c58e4c8aaefe1c57f336dd75369ca250"
61516138
dependencies = [
61526139
"bitflags",
6140+
"hashbrown",
61536141
"indexmap",
61546142
"semver",
6143+
"serde",
61556144
]
61566145

61576146
[[package]]
61586147
name = "wast"
6159-
version = "236.0.1"
6148+
version = "237.0.0"
61606149
source = "registry+https://github.com/rust-lang/crates.io-index"
6161-
checksum = "d3bec4b4db9c6808d394632fd4b0cd4654c32c540bd3237f55ee6a40fff6e51f"
6150+
checksum = "fcf66f545acbd55082485cb9a6daab54579cb8628a027162253e8e9f5963c767"
61626151
dependencies = [
61636152
"bumpalo",
61646153
"leb128fmt",
61656154
"memchr",
61666155
"unicode-width 0.2.1",
6167-
"wasm-encoder 0.236.1",
6156+
"wasm-encoder 0.237.0",
61686157
]
61696158

61706159
[[package]]
61716160
name = "wat"
6172-
version = "1.236.1"
6161+
version = "1.237.0"
61736162
source = "registry+https://github.com/rust-lang/crates.io-index"
6174-
checksum = "64475e2f77d6071ce90624098fc236285ddafa8c3ea1fb386f2c4154b6c2bbdb"
6163+
checksum = "27975186f549e4b8d6878b627be732863883c72f7bf4dcf8f96e5f8242f73da9"
61756164
dependencies = [
61766165
"wast",
61776166
]
@@ -6660,9 +6649,9 @@ dependencies = [
66606649

66616650
[[package]]
66626651
name = "wit-component"
6663-
version = "0.234.0"
6652+
version = "0.237.0"
66646653
source = "registry+https://github.com/rust-lang/crates.io-index"
6665-
checksum = "5a8888169acf4c6c4db535beb405b570eedac13215d6821ca9bd03190f7f8b8c"
6654+
checksum = "bfb7674f76c10e82fe00b256a9d4ffb2b8d037d42ab8e9a83ebb3be35c9d0bf6"
66666655
dependencies = [
66676656
"anyhow",
66686657
"bitflags",
@@ -6671,17 +6660,17 @@ dependencies = [
66716660
"serde",
66726661
"serde_derive",
66736662
"serde_json",
6674-
"wasm-encoder 0.234.0",
6663+
"wasm-encoder 0.237.0",
66756664
"wasm-metadata",
6676-
"wasmparser 0.234.0",
6665+
"wasmparser 0.237.0",
66776666
"wit-parser",
66786667
]
66796668

66806669
[[package]]
66816670
name = "wit-parser"
6682-
version = "0.234.0"
6671+
version = "0.237.0"
66836672
source = "registry+https://github.com/rust-lang/crates.io-index"
6684-
checksum = "465492df47d8dcc015a3b7f241aed8ea03688fee7c5e04162285c5b1a3539c8b"
6673+
checksum = "ce2596a5bc7c24cc965b56ad6ff9e32394c4e401764f89620a888519c6e849ab"
66856674
dependencies = [
66866675
"anyhow",
66876676
"id-arena",
@@ -6692,7 +6681,7 @@ dependencies = [
66926681
"serde_derive",
66936682
"serde_json",
66946683
"unicode-xid",
6695-
"wasmparser 0.234.0",
6684+
"wasmparser 0.237.0",
66966685
]
66976686

66986687
[[package]]

src/tools/tidy/src/deps.rs

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-361,7 +361,6 @@ const PERMITTED_RUSTC_DEPENDENCIES: &[&str] = &[
361361
"scoped-tls",
362362
"scopeguard",
363363
"self_cell",
364-
"semver",
365364
"serde",
366365
"serde_derive",
367366
"serde_json",

src/tools/wasm-component-ld/Cargo.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,4 +10,4 @@ name = "wasm-component-ld"
1010
path = "src/main.rs"
1111

1212
[dependencies]
13-
wasm-component-ld = "0.5.14"
13+
wasm-component-ld = "0.5.16"

0 commit comments

Comments
 (0)